School Health Screening



From Your School Nurse

As part of the eight components of School Health, School Nurses conduct periodic vision, dental, hearing, blood pressure, and other screenings as recommended by SC DHEC, and as needed as part of the nurse's assessment during a health room visit. These screenings are important in early detection of hearing or vision difficulties that may impact teaching and learning. Many times a student is not even aware he/she is having difficulty seeing the board, reading, or hearing classroom instructions. 

The Students at Forest Lake Elementary are currently being screened for the 2016-2017 year. Please contact Martha Becht, RN, your school nurse, if you have a question or a concern regarding your child's results, or if you need assistance taking your child to the eye doctor or dentist. Our goal is to work in collaboration with parents, teachers and children to help children stay healthy so they can learn.

Forest Lake Elementary Wins Read Your Way to the Big Game Contest!



TWO ELEMENTARY SCHOOLS WIN STATEWIDE READING CONTEST
Forest Lake Elementary and Round Top Elementary schools are winners in the “Read Your Way to the Big Game” Contest, a statewide reading challenge held this fall for students in public primary, elementary and middle schools. The South Carolina Education Oversight Committee made the announcement this week. Student winners of the contest have won tickets to the Palmetto Bowl, to be played by the University of South Carolina Gamecock and Clemson Tiger football teams on Saturday, Nov. 26. 
Forest Lake and Round Top students met the goal of having 70 percent of their students participate in the contest.

Commercial Crew Contest

Here's an opportunity for
our young artist to shine.

Commercial Crew
2017 Calendar Artwork
Contest

Nov. 30 is deadline for contest entries!
Credits: NASA
NASA’s Commercial Crew Program is holding an artwork contest through November 30 for children  4 to 12 years old. The artwork will be used to create a 2017 calendar, which has a different space-related theme for each month. The themes educate students about the International Space Station, astronauts, growing food in space and more! Unique and original artwork will be selected for each month. Once the calendar is complete, it will be transmitted to astronauts aboard the  space station. The calendar also will include supplemental education materials for kids here on Earth to learn more about the space-related themes.
